ZIP 57564 and ZIP 57566 are ZIP Code areas in South Dakota.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 57566 has the higher population (1,136 vs 893 in ZIP 57564). ZIP 57564 has the higher median household income ($71,708 vs $16,553 in ZIP 57566). ZIP 57564 has the higher median home value ($199,100 vs $10,300 in ZIP 57566).
